What is IBXu2dbDTV.x64.dll?

IBXu2dbDTV.x64.dll is part of storage a and developed by storage a according to the IBXu2dbDTV.x64.dll version information.

IBXu2dbDTV.x64.dll's description is "DBMS any computers"

IBXu2dbDTV.x64.dll is usually located in the 'C:\ProgramData\CoNveerrter Maste\' folder.

Some of the anti-virus scanners at VirusTotal detected IBXu2dbDTV.x64.dll.

VirusTotal report

11 of the 28 anti-virus programs at VirusTotal detected the IBXu2dbDTV.x64.dll file. That's a 39% detection rate.

ScannerDetection Name
AhnLab-V3 Trojan/Win64.Preloader
Baidu-International Adware.Win64.MultiPlug.C
BitDefender Adware.Generic.939645
Emsisoft Adware.Generic.939645 (B)
GData Adware.Generic.939645
K7AntiVirus Adware ( 004997a51 )
K7GW Adware ( 004997a51 )
Malwarebytes PUP.Optional.MultiPlug.A
MicroWorld-eScan Adware.Generic.939645
Qihoo-360 Win32/Trojan.Adware.453
Tencent Win64.Adware.Multiplug.Lmbj
11 of the 28 anti-virus programs detected the IBXu2dbDTV.x64.dll file.
